Description

Blade Runner is a cinematic point‑and‑click adventure set in Ridley Scott's iconic cyber‑punk universe. Players assume the role of a replicant hunter, exploring a rain‑soaked Los Angeles while interrogating suspects and piecing together clues. The game blends atmospheric storytelling with challenging puzzles, delivering a faithful adaptation of the film's noir aesthetic. Its richly detailed environments and branching dialogue choices immerse players in a world of intrigue and moral ambiguity.

Cyberpunk 2077: Ultimate Edition is an action role-playing game set in a dystopian future in Night City. The game features a vast open world, engaging storyline, and immersive gameplay mechanics. Players take on the role of V, a mercenary outlaw, and must navigate the city's underworld, complete quests, and make choices that impact the game's outcome.

The Verdict

AI-generated from listing data

Blade Runner offers a classic, story‑driven point‑and‑click adventure at a low price, while Cyberpunk 2077 delivers a modern, expansive RPG with deep customization at a higher cost.

Key differences

  • Genre & gameplay: point‑and‑click adventure vs. open‑world action RPG.
  • Scope & length: limited, narrative‑focused puzzles vs. vast, explorable Night City with combat.
  • Price: $19.99 one‑time vs. $59.99 one‑time.
  • Release era & tech: 1997 pixel art with dated graphics vs. 2023 high‑fidelity 3D graphics.
  • Replay value sources: multiple story endings from dialogue choices vs. character builds, gear, and open‑world activities.
